Sydney Marin Chapter 7

“I will think of away,” she whispered to herself. Bringing up my courage, I spoke to her. “I don’t want to go somewhere unknown. I know how to cook and I will take care of myself. I won’t go back.” She looked up at me convincingly but all she replied is “It’s settled, Sydney. I need to ask any of my friends to take care of you and also, I’m thinking of giving you the training to learn all witch skills. It’s your time to study.” For a minute I felt like hearing one bad news and another good one. Staying in some unknown person’s house is not a good idea, even though they are Lydia’s friends. I will feel uncomfortable living with some other witch’s house. Anyway, she said this is the time for my studies. Is that mean I will join any academy? Wow. If it’s true I’m so happy right now. I want to join the sapphire Academy. “Where will I be studying?” “I didn’t think of that. You will learn under the guidance of a witch at the home. You are not going anywhere. You will stay at one of my friend’s houses. They will help you with everything. Now I need to think who will take the responsibility of having you in their house.” She calmly said, taking her home and going to her room without even finishing her breakfast. All my expectations turned to disappointment in a second. Seriously, this is how am I going to live the rest of my life. ‘Cool. Congratulations Sydney. Your aunt will not do what you wanted.’ I spent the rest of the day admiring the house I’m living in and the surroundings. What if the person who’s going to take care of me is strict? They won’t let me enjoy my life as I wanted. I should have been grateful for my current life which is going far away from me. .... I’m in my white slip with a blue short skirt heading towards the stairs. It’s not even midnight, but I am going to sleep. “Hey Sydney, Come here.” My aunt called me impatiently. “What’s now?” I muttered with irritation. “Pack your things in three or four days. My friend Nina will take care of you. She’s such a good person and your training will be really useful. I’m sure you will enjoy it.” She gladly announced. I’m not sure how should I react. It’s nothing interesting to study alone. “Okay aunt, have a delightful journey. Return as soon as you can.” I said with some hope. But she looked disappointed the moment I spoke. “I will try my best. This work is the most dangerous thing I’m ever doing. I need to bring back the life of a dead person, a witch and the need to destroy a demon that possessed a body. There have been many cases going around like this. I’m not sure of my return.” She simply answered, but I feel uncertain about it. My mom and dad have died by doing powerful spells which drained all their energy from their body. Now she’s going somewhere to do something more dangerous. It won’t end well. “Are you saying you won’t return? Tell me you are kidding. If it’s a dangerous one, why are you doing it?” I slammed my fist on the nearby table so hard it hurt. She’s not at all angry at my response. She’s looking at me like this is the last time she will ever see me. I don’t want that. I will rather stay in the same home than send her off to some life-taking risks. She can’t do many spells all by herself. The only family left for me is her. Lydia. “I already tried to back off from the work but the situation is going really worse. I can’t let many lives in danger by sitting here. They said they will give me a million dollars to do this. But I’m not working for money. I’m doing this to save lives. You should trust me, have faith in me. I will come back.” She tried to bring some confidence. “I will trust you, but you should promise me you will come back no matter what. I am not going to lose you.” I controlled my tears and hugged her. After some silence, we both calmed ourselves. “Go, sleep now.” She smiled at me. These days I rarely see her smile. Finally, I walked to my room, not being frustrated. I’m ready to go to Nina’s house for my aunt. I hope Nina will be nice to me. I closed the door behind me slowly and when I looked up, I saw someone’s shadow in my window. “What the fuck” I cursed and blinked a few times in confusion. The window is wide open, but that person is still holding on to it is… That’s Jacen. “Jacen?” I whispered in shock. “Can I come inside?” He asked me. I hurried towards the end and shrieked. “What the hell are you doing here? My aunt is in the hall.” “We can talk about that once I’m inside. Now can I come in?” “But” I hesitated without understanding the most common thing. He’s a vampire. “Oh my god, Sydney. I can’t come inside without your permission. Tell me, can I come in?” “Sorry. You can come in, Jacen.” I said after the fact struck my mind. I was making him wait for so long. He can’t come inside without anyone’s permission. “Why are you here at this time?” I whispered silently. “You ignored my message the whole day. So, I worried about you.” He simply replied. I was so upset today that I didn’t even see my phone. I was absent-minded for the whole day. But I never have an idea he will really sneak to my house. I thought he was just joking that day. He stalked my slatecity account. “I didn’t ignore you. You should have called me. Now go to your home.” I ordered. “I’m not going,” he smirked, and his eyes roamed my whole body. ‘Oh no, I’m in my nightdress. You are stupid, Sydney.’ I scolded myself. “Hey. Turn around. I need to change my dress.” I almost screamed, and he did what I asked. I rushed to get my shirt and went to the restroom. When I’m back, he was sitting on my bed and seeing my room and many CDs of games. “You have so many games. Did you play it all?” he examined some of it. “Yeah. That’s my all-time job.” I replied, sitting next to him. “I know you didn’t ignore me but is everything alright?” he asked me, concerned. “Not really. I’m sending off to some witch house for nearly six months. Cause my aunt is going somewhere to destroy some demon and some other issues, etc... I don’t know about it clearly.” “six months is too long. From what I have heard, your aunt never went anywhere more than a month, right?” He told me correctly. A guy who knows everything. That got to be Jacen in the whole slateville. “Yes. Now she...” Suddenly I trailed off hearing my aunt’s voice. “Sydney, who are you talking with?” I heard footsteps and her voice. Why she’s coming to my room right now? This is not the right time.
